en Anyone who enters the magazine business in China should be thinking long-term, because it is definitely tough out there. There is no easy money to be made. And Chinese magazines have learned the tricks of the trade. They have learned very fast how to make glossy magazines that are easy to read and attract ads. And local publications have many fewer regulatory obstacles to fight than the foreign titles.
